Job Description

Precision Aviation Group (PAG) is a leading provider of products and valueadded services to the aerospace and defense industries worldwide. With over 1.1 million squarefeet of sales and services facilities in the United States Canada Australia Singapore Brazil PAGs 27 locations and customerfocused business model serve aviation customers through Supply Chain and Inventory Supported Maintenance Repair and Overhaul (ISMRO) services.

JOB PURPOSE

The technician will use knowledge skills experience and good judgement to produce a reliable quality airworthy product at a reasonable cost and optimum turn time while providing the highest quality of workmanship for all work accomplished.

J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Essential Job Functions:

  • Use repair station tooling to disassemble clean inspect repair assemble and test components.
  • Can read and interpret component maintenance manuals.
  • Possess moderate computer skills that allow for repair data input and be able to manually log work performed onto work order dispositions and component log cards.
  • Maintain a clean and orderly work area that promotes a team first environment allowing for all employees to productively share the workspace.
  • Be adept at working with mechanical and electrical components and systems.

WORKING CONDITIONS

Physical Demands: This job is performed in a an indoor climatecontrolled environment. Job tasks will require use of hand tools long periods of standing and the applicant must have the ability to lift 50 pounds independently.

Work Location: 220 Burgess Drive Units 2 3 4 Broussard Louisiana 70518

JOB SPECIFICATIONS

Knowledge Skills and Abilities: Aviation maintenance is preferred but not required. A general mechanical and/or electrical understanding is desired. NonDestructive Testing experience (specifically in liquid penetrant magnetic particle and eddy current disciplines) are a plus.

Certificates/Licenses: Airframe and/or Powerplant license not required but considered.

We offer competitive pay and a wide variety of benefits. Full time associates qualify for health benefits the first of the month following 30 days employment. Options include 4 medical plans 2 dental plans vision base life (company paid) voluntary life short and longterm disability flex spending accounts and telemedicine. Other benefits include vacation and PTO time accrued with each pay cycle with a vacation carryover/payout option at year end 9 paid holidays 401k with company match contributions.
